Hi, sorry if this is a silly question, I'm quite new to love2d.
I was running 0.10.2 (which I installed quite soon before 11 was reased), and I decided to upgrade and adapt my game so it would be compatible. Once I did this, trying to run love resulted in the error:
love: error while loading shared libraries: liblove-11.1.so: cannot open shared object file: No such file or directory
I see in the software center that love is not installed there (I uninstalled love 0.10.2 before installing 11.1), so I decide to install it there via GUI as well (which I guess is responsible for the following?)
So I find liblove-11.1.so hidden in /snap, which certainly wasn't how 0.10.2 was stored, figure out I can run love with love2d instead of love. This is a little inconvenient for love-minor-mode on emacs, but I guess I can make it work (just aliasing doesn't fix it). but ok, I could just fix that within the .el itself. Biggest problem is that now love2d can't find the libraries I had placed in it's path for usage (which worked fine in 0.10.2)
e.g.
[...]
no file '/usr/share/lua/5.1/monocle/init.lua'
[...]
Which is a file that definitely exists, and that lua5.1 can find by itself.
When lua 0.10.2 just worked that was nice. What's up with all the hassle for 11.1?
at this point I'd be happy just to downgrade back to a working 0.10.2, but can't find an option for that either (love=0.10.2 ... Version '0.10.2' for 'love' was not found).
Any advice,is appreciated.

Okay, let's do this one by one..
I'm guessing you're running ubuntu (supported by what's ahead). It looks like you only updated the love package, but haven't updated the liblove package. The easiest and smoothest way to rectify this is by running a system update as normal.
Surprising, but I'm fairly sure it explains the following because...
It seems to have installed a snap instead! I'm not sure which snap it is, or where it came from, but here we are.
Well, that's both the advantage and disadvantage of snaps: they are sandboxed. So it can't actually access your system-installed lua libraries.TheHUG wrote: ↑Tue Jul 10, 2018 12:49 pm Biggest problem is that now love2d can't find the libraries I had placed in it's path for usage (which worked fine in 0.10.2)
e.g.
[...]
no file '/usr/share/lua/5.1/monocle/init.lua'
[...]
Which is a file that definitely exists, and that lua5.1 can find by itself.
My advice: remove the snap, update your system to install the latest version of liblove, and enjoy.

Thanks, I managed a workaround for now by adding the snap's /share/lib file to my LD_LIBRARY_PATH. I'll try a system update and see if that fixes it all.
Thanks for the reply raidho, I think I am using the PPA, I added it with:
sudo add-apt-repository ppa:bartbes/love-stable
sudo apt-get update
and the love version I have is labelled as 11.1ppa1
